Microsoft Patch Enables Hotswapping Amd Gpus In Linux Systems
Microsoft is synonymous with cloud computing with its Azure server technology in several enterprises globally. Currently, the company utilizes AMD data center GPUs and Linux in their servers. However, when a new GPU needs to be replaced or installed into their servers, it demands that the server shut down to change graphics card units. A particular driver for GPU disaggregation technology, intended for AMD graphics cards, receives assistance from engineers at Microsoft Microsoft has created a unique driver to enable “hot-plugging” for the AMD GPUs on their Linux servers to initiate these replacements....
